In 1886, Ronald Alexander McPherson entered the world in Port Melbourne, Victoria, Australia, born to Ronald Valentine Mc Pherson Twin And Isabella Bennett. Ronald Alexander McPherson passed away in 1956 in North Brighton, Victoria, Australia.
